Stewardship Message for Nov 12

By now, everyone should have received an email regarding St Andrew’s Stewardship campaign for 2020-2021.  With the covid pandemic expected to be here for at least several more months, planning has become more difficult than normal.

While the church continues to operate smoothly under this strange and different situation, with limited in person attendance, our financial giving this year has fallen. To the end of October our revenues were about $20,000 below budget, however our expenses have been about $30,000 lower than planned.  (From April to August our expected operating costs were reduced, thanks to significant contributions by the Diocese, in reduced clergy salary and assessment costs).  As of September 1, we were responsible for meeting all our operating expenses going forward.  To help, we did have a successful Halloween basket fundraiser bringing in over $1600.  We are planning another similar event around Christmas.

The first goal of this Stewardship campaign is to ensure that we continue to receive the revenues necessary to sustain church operations and repay our debts.   For our revenues to match our expenses through the last 4 months of 2020, we are looking for $30,000 in contributions before year end.

Please take the time to consider how you can help and remember to print and complete the pledge form and either drop it off or mail it to the church on or before Sunday November 29, 2020.

If you wish to complete the form on line and email it to the Envelope Secretary, Carl Markwart at markwartfam@telus.net that would also be fine.

This year in particular, your completion of the pledge form will be of significant help to us as we develop our plans for 2021.

(Remember, a pledge is a statement of your intentions. We recognize that circumstances can change, and you can adjust your donations (upwards or downwards) if your financial situation changes.)

PWRDF Advent Calendar


From our homes to your home

 Dear PWRDF friend and supporter,

This year Advent and Christmas promise to be unusual, so we at PWRDF challenged ourselves to think a little outside the box. This year's annual Advent resource is reminiscent of an Advent calendar. 
We will count down the days until Christmas, opening a window to PWRDF's work each day. An At-Home Advent won't feature daily chocolate (feel free to bring you own!), but will feature a daily home-made video message from a PWRDF staffer or volunteer, accompanied by a scripture passage and prayer. When you subscribe, you will receive an email every day of Advent with a story of how PWRDF has shaped each of us in different ways.
As you celebrate the season – some of you at home and some of you in your churches – we invite you to make PWRDF part of your Advent prayers, too.

If you wish to continue to donate to St. Andrew’s during this time, you can do so utilizing our PAD (Pre-Authorized Debit) option. Once a month, on or after the 12th, we submit to RBC our PAD file to automatically debit from your bank account. If the 12th falls on a weekend or statutory holiday, we process the file the next bank business day. To begin this process, call Carl Markwart at 604-575-3068 to provide your name and banking information. Three bank details are needed (usually taken from the bottom of a void cheque) – your bank’s transit number, bank number and your personal bank account number.

Alternatively, you can drop off your weekly envelopes through the church’s mail slot or mail your donation to St. Andrew’s 20955 Old Yale Rd, Langley City BC V3A 7P8.   

There is also the option of e-transfer. You can just send it to the church’s email,  standrewslangley@shaw.ca, and it will be sent to our Treasurer.
